Of all of the fabrics utilized in bicycle frames and elements, carbon fiber is possibly probably the most usually misunderstood. Whilst it has a name for computerized production devoid of human touch or soul, it’s in fact way more labor-intensive subject matter than metals. Trendy modular monocoque frames, as an example, contain masses of particular person items of carbon material, virtually all of which might be laid through hand ahead of in the end curing in a mildew below intense warmth and power.

It’s best thru such elaborate production processes that we’re ready to get such a lot efficiency out of such extremely light-weight buildings. Then again, that complexity additionally introduces better risk for human error, and in spite of maximum carbon-fiber frames and elements taking a look ideal at the floor, it’s commonplace for the ones merchandise to be less-than-perfect beneath, even on brand-new pieces contemporary from the manufacturing facility flooring.

Voids and wrinkles are the commonest defects, and their severity can range from merchandise to merchandise, as can their have an effect on on a product’s power and function.

Carbon fiber bicycle frames are manufactured from masses of particular person items of pre-preg carbon, which might be virtually all the time positioned through hand. Such element is what permits carbon buildings to offer such fantastic efficiency for a given weight, but it surely additionally introduces the potential of human error.

Generally, the ones defects have minimum (if any) real-world have an effect on, with numerous structural redundancy to offset no matter structural deficiencies there could be because of this. That’s now not all the time true, alternatively, and firms are continuously striving to cut back — and even do away with — the frequency of the ones defects from the producing procedure.
